The Atlantic City Arts Foundation highlighted the work of Chanelle René, a South Jersey painter and muralist whose newest installation, “Saints + Sinners,” transformed The Ministry of ARTeriors into a reflective space of light, color, and reclaimed identity. The exhibit invites visitors to explore themes of belonging, grace, and transformation through the lens of Black culture and the female experience.
